Transaction 740373af36e4c2e1d7d0bb9e5cf839a863c6cf8f4c581fc05e366d8a2e9766a9
2 Input
2 Outputs
- 740373af36e4c2e1d7d0bb9e5cf839a863c6cf8f4c581fc05e366d8a2e9766a9:0
- 740373af36e4c2e1d7d0bb9e5cf839a863c6cf8f4c581fc05e366d8a2e9766a9:1
value 8606235
address 1C7mJd14YtoRCE1oTPegFTM87VshYFbR9R
value 1388265
address 12vcW84E21vKDAAk1JraUg2DGEDMUU6nPN